§ 53-14-106. License — Contents — Expiration — Nontransferable

All licenses issued pursuant to § 53-14-105 shall specify: The name and address of the licensees; The nature of the authorized project or projects; The nature of legend drugs, controlled substances or controlled substance analogues to be used in the project; and Whether dispensing to human subjects is permitted. § 53-14-108. Denial of Application for License

If an application for a license or amendment under this chapter is denied, the director shall notify the applicant in writing of the reason or reasons for the denial. The applicant may, within thirty (30) days of the date of the notification, submit responsive materials for consideration by the commissioner.

§ 53-14-109. Institutional Applicants for Licenses

Any institution that regularly engages in research, instruction or chemical analysis may apply for a license authorizing internal approval of specific projects conducted under the institution’s immediate auspices.
